Fast Food, Big Impact

There is always excitement at the beginning of a new year, with renewed hopes of health, wealth, and happiness. It’s no different in the limited-service industry, where brands are studying up on potential trends for the next 12 months to ensure a prosperous 2014.

For now, operators are feeling cautiously optimistic about the next year. The National Restaurant Association’s (NRA) most recent Restaurant Performance Index, a measure that tracks the industry’s health and outlook, was on the upswing after a late-2013 swoon.

Potentially faster economic growth this year will be a positive for restaurants, observers say, and consumers are already growing more confident thanks to an improving jobs picture.
